The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Tameside local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 2 KESTREL CLOSE sales between June 2005 and March 2025 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the November 2013 sale was for 15%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 15% above the HPI over time, until the March 2025 sale, where it rises to 17%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 17% above the HPI.

2 KESTREL C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£434,092.
This is based on house price inflation of 4.6%, between March 2025 and April 2026, for detached houses, in the Tameside local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
